Here is the sequence from the book. I think that they have steps 1 and 3 reversed (I'm refering to the 4 spd auto scenerio):

1 Shift transmission to neutral
2 Shift transmission into drive and make sure there is no vehicle movement
3 Shift transfer case into neutral
4 Turn ignition key to unlocked off position
5 Shift transmission into park
6 Attach vehicle to tow vehicle with tow bar.

If steps 1 and 3 were reversed it would then make sense to me.
I believe the end result is supposed to be transfer case in neutral (test by putting transmission in drive and seeing that it is really in transfer case neutral) and then the trans in Park but steering in the unlocked position so it can track behind the tow vehicle. Is that correct?
